파이썬에서 미니 프로젝트로 실력 키우기: 시작을 위한 다짐
파이썬은 프로그래밍에 처음 입문하는 이들에게 적합한 언어입니다. 미니 프로젝트는 실력을 키우는 데 매우 효과적인 방법이죠. 다양한 주제와 난이도로 자신만의 프로젝트를 만들어보며 실력을 늘릴 수 있습니다. 이를 통해 코드 작성 능력은 물론 문제 해결 능력까지 향상될 것입니다. 많은 사람들은 한 번쯤은 파이썬에 매료되곤 하는데, 그 매력을 한층 더할 수 있는 것이 바로 프로젝트 경험이죠.
미니 프로젝트를 통해 실력을 키우겠다는 다짐이 필요합니다. 이런 다짐은 단순한 목표가 아니라, 스스로에 대한 약속이 됩니다. 간단한 것부터 시작해 보세요. 예를 들어, 날씨 API를 활용한 애플리케이션이나 간단한 게임을 만드는 것도 좋겠어요. 이런 시작은 여러분에게 큰 자신감을 줄 수 있습니다. 실제로 손에 잡히는 결과물을 만들어내는 과정은 매우 보람차기 때문이죠.
프로젝트를 시작하기 전에 어떤 주제를 선택할지를 고민해야 합니다. 자신의 관심사와 연관된 프로젝트를 선택한다면 더 좋은 결과를 얻을 수 있습니다. 취미와 관련된 앱을 만들거나, 일상에서 느낀 불편함을 해결하기 위한 도구를 개발하는 것이죠. 이런 방식으로 진행하면 지속적으로 동기부여를 받을 수 있습니다. 자신에게 맞는 프로젝트를 찾고, 이를 통해 뭔가를 만들어내는 과정은 정말 즐겁습니다.
어떤 언어든 프로젝트를 시작할 때는 초기 단계에서 많은 시간과 노력이 필요합니다. 파이썬에서 미니 프로젝트로 실력 키우기 위해선 먼저 환경을 설정하고 필요한 라이브러리를 설치해보는 것이죠. 이러한 작은 단계들이 모여 큰 성공을 이루게 됩니다. 이 과정을 통해 프로그래밍의 기본기를 확실히 다질 수 있습니다. 특히 파이썬에서는 다양한 라이브러리를 제공하므로 그 활용법을 익히는 것도 중요합니다.
미니 프로젝트는 혼자서도 즐기고, 함께 공유할 수 있는 좋은 활동입니다. 자신이 만든 프로젝트를 주변 친구들과 공유해 보세요. 피드백을 통해 더 나은 방향으로 발전할 수 있습니다. 그렇게 되면 단순한 코드 작성이 아닌, 여러 사람과의 소통과 협력으로 인해 시너지를 얻을 수 있습니다. 이 역시 파이썬에서 미니 프로젝트로 실력을 키우는 멋진 방법이겠죠!
이런 작은 시작들이 결국 큰 변화를 만듭니다. 여러분이 작은 프로젝트부터 시작해 다양한 경험을 쌓아간다면, 어느 순간 실력이 눈에 띄게 향상되었음을 느낄 수 있을 것입니다. 그러니까 두려움 없이 도전하세요. 파이썬의 매력은 바로 여러분이 상상하는 모든 것을 구현할 수 있는 가능성에 있습니다!
효율적인 프로젝트 관리: 계획과 실천
미니 프로젝트를 진행할 때는 효율적으로 계획을 세우는 것이 중요합니다. 복잡하게 구상할 필요는 없습니다. 간단한 단계로 나누어 목표를 정하고 우선순위를 매기면 됩니다. 각 단계별로 필요한 자원과 시간을 고려하여 일정을 계획하세요. 이 과정을 통해 여러분은 더욱 체계적인 작업 방식을 배울 수 있습니다. 프로그래밍에서는 이렇게 잘 세운 계획이 더 좋은 결과를 만듭니다.
일단 시작한 프로젝트가 중간에 포기되거나 지치지 않도록, 작은 목표를 설정하는 것이 좋습니다. 예를 들어, 하루에 한 페이지의 코드를 작성하는 것부터 시작해보세요. 그러면 작은 성취감을 느낄 수 있으며, 이는 다시 도전할 수 있는 원동력이 됩니다. 매일 코드를 짜는 습관을 통해 자연스럽게 실력이 늘어날 것입니다. 파이썬에서 미니 프로젝트로 실력 키우기 위해서는 꾸준함이 가장 중요하죠.
또한, 실습을 통해 배운 이론 또한 정리해 두세요. 인강이나 책에서 배운 내용을 프로젝트와 연결해보세요. 이렇게 되면 단순한 암기가 아닌 실제 적용으로 대체될 수 있습니다. 여러분이 선택한 주제를 중심으로 관련 이론을 탐구해 보세요. 예를 들어, 게임을 만들면서 알고리즘이나 데이터 구조에 대해 공부할 수 있습니다. 여러 지식을 프로젝트에 녹여내는 것이죠.
팀 프로젝트의 경우 협업도 중요합니다. 함께 진행하는 사람들과 자주 소통하고 의견을 나누세요. 아이디어를 모으고 서로의 코드를 리뷰하면 많은 것을 배울 수 있습니다. 그런 과정 속에서 파이썬의 다양한 문법과 기능을 익힐 수 있는 기회를 가질 수 있습니다. 단순히 혼자 작업하는 것보다 서로의 경험을 공유하면 더욱 폭넓은 시각을 갖게 됩니다. 또, 어떤 문제를 어떻게 해결했는지도 배울 수 있죠.
프로젝트의 실패를 두려워하지 마세요. 모든 과정에서 배움이 있습니다. 실패는 여러분의 성장에 중요한 요소입니다. 잘 되지 않는 부분에 대해서도 꾸준히 고민하고 해법을 찾아보세요. 그런 과정을 통해 문제해결 능력이 개발될 것입니다. 파이썬에서 미니 프로젝트로 실력 키우기를 위해서는 이런 태도가 필요합니다. 모든 도전이 여러분에게 도움이 됩니다!
마지막으로, 결과물을 마무리한 후 반성하는 시간을 가지세요. 프로젝트 등록이나 블로그에 기록하고, 경험한 것들을 공유하면 좋습니다. 배운 점을 정리하고, 다음 프로젝트에 적용하는 것이죠. 이렇게 피드백 과정을 통해 실력을 연마할 수 있습니다. 그리고 여러분의 성장을 타인과 나누는 것, 이는 여러분이 이 분야에서 더 발전할 수 있는 중요한 경험이 됩니다!
미니 프로젝트를 위한 자료 조사와 도구 선택
프로젝트를 진행하기 전에 꼭 필요한 것이 바로 자료 조사입니다. 자신이 진행할 프로젝트의 주제에 대해 충분히 조사하여 아이디어를 구체화하세요. 간단한 검색만으로도 많은 정보가 나옵니다. 블로그, 개발자 포럼, GitHub 등에서 관련 자료를 찾아보는 것도 좋은 방법이죠. 이런 정보를 통해 프로젝트의 방향성을 잡고, 자신만의 아이디어를 실현할 수 있습니다.
또한, 프로젝트에 활용할 도구를 선택하는 것도 중요합니다. 파이썬에서는 다양한 라이브러리와 프레임워크가 존재하므로, 이를 잘 활용하면 프로젝트의 완성도를 높일 수 있습니다. 예를 들어, 데이터 분석에는 Pandas와 Matplotlib을, 웹 애플리케이션 구축에는 Flask나 Django를 이용하는 것이죠. 이런 도구들을 통해 여러분의 프로젝트를 보다 전문적으로 발전시킬 수 있습니다.
한편, 파이썬에서 미니 프로젝트로 실력 키우기 위해 자신에게 적합한 난이도를 설정하는 것이 중요합니다. 초보자라면 너무 어려운 프로젝트를 선택하면 금세 지칠 수 있습니다. 너무 쉽게 생각하지 말고 도전할 수 있는 범위 내에서 본인의 수준에 맞는 주제를 선택하세요. 과하지 않은 도전이 여러분을 성장시키는 밑바탕이 될 것입니다.
프로젝트 중간에는 점검하는 시간을 가져보세요. 진행 상황을 체크하고 필요에 따라 미세 조정이 이루어져야 할지 고민해보는 시간을요. 이 과정을 통해 일을 더 효과적으로 추진할 수 있습니다. 스스로의 진전을 바라보며, 성취감을 느낄 수 있을 것입니다. 미니 프로젝트일수록 목표를 정확하게 체크하는 게 가능합니다.
마지막으로, 만든 결과물을 외부와 공유하면 더욱 큰 보람을 느낄 수 있습니다. GitHub에 올리고, 블로그를 통해 사람들에게 알리는 것도 좋죠. 이렇게 되면 여러분은 다른 사람들의 피드백을 받을 수 있고, 이는 여러분이 더 나은 개발자로 성장하는 데 큰 도움이 됩니다. 파이썬의 세계는 넓고 가능성도 무한하니, 최고의 도전이 될 것입니다!
결과적으로, 미니 프로젝트로 실력을 쌓기 위해선 자료 조사가 필수적입니다. 적절한 도구를 선택하고, 프로젝트의 목표를 설정하며 이는 여러분의 성공적인 개발자로 성장하는 길로 이어질 것입니다. 도전하는 과정에서 배움의 즐거움과 보람을 느끼는 것이죠. 지금 이 순간이 바로 시작입니다!
프로젝트 사례와 그로 인한 성장
앞서 말씀드린 대로, 여러 가지 미니 프로젝트를 통해 어떤 결과를 얻을 수 있을까요? 예를 들어, 나만의 To-Do 리스트 앱 만들기에 도전해보세요. 사용자가 할 일을 추가하고, 완료한 작업을 삭제하는 기본적인 기능을 구현할 수 있죠. 이 과정에서 사용자의 입력을 처리하고, 조건문과 반복문을 사용하는 경험을 쌓을 수 있을 것입니다. 토대로 웹 나 이라고 꼬리표를 달아도 좋습니다.
또한, 소셜 미디어 분석 프로그램을 만드는 것도 훌륭한 프로젝트입니다. 예를 들어, Twitter API를 사용하여 특정 해시태그를 포함한 트윗을 수집하고, 그 통계치를 시각적으로 표현하는 프로그램을 만들어보세요. 이를 통해 웹 API 사용법을 익히고, 데이터 분석의 기초를 배울 수 있습니다. 이런 경험은 여러분의 실력을 한 단계 업그레이드 해주는 귀중한 자산이 됩니다.
정말 재미있는 것을 하려면 게임을 만들어보는 것도 좋죠! 예를 들어, 간단한 사칙연산 게임을 구현하여 사용자에게 문제를 내고 정답을 맞히는 프로그램을 만들어보세요. 이 과정에서 파이썬의 기본적인 문법과 사용자 인터페이스 관련 라이브러리인 Tkinter를 다루게 될 것입니다. 무엇보다도 중간중간 유머와 자극적인 요소를 추가한다면, 흥미로운 결과물을 낼 수 있습니다!
이처럼 다양한 프로젝트를 통해 얻는 경험은 실력을 쌓는 것을 넘어, 여러분이 원하는 방향으로 자신의 개발 세계를 관철하는 것입니다. 프로젝트는 자신만의 고민과 창의력을 발휘하는 공간이기도 합니다. 파이썬에서 미니 프로젝트로 실력 키우기란 다른 사람의 프로젝트를 단순히 모방하는 것이 아니라, 스스로의 아이디어를 통해 풀어내는 과정입니다.
프로젝트가 끝난 후에는 결과를 기록하고, 어떤 점에서 성장을 이루었는지 돌아보세요. 이 과정을 통해 자신만의 발전을 느낄 수 있습니다. 경험들을 정리한 블로그 글을 작성해 보거나, 관련 커뮤니티에 게시하면 자신만의 실력을 쌓아갈 수 있는 기반이 형성됩니다. 그는 그러한 과정을 통해 또 다른 기회를 얻게 되겠죠!
마지막으로, 다양한 프로젝트를 시도하면서 여러분의 성장 기록을 남기는 것도 중요합니다. 이렇게 경험을 쌓는 과정이 쌓이고 쌓여, 결국 그 누구에게도 아닌 여러분만의 고유한 개발 여정이 되는 것입니다. 파이썬에서 미니 프로젝트로 실력 키우기를 통해 여러분의 이야기를 계속 이어가세요!
미니 프로젝트 정리와 데이터 시각화
프로젝트를 진행하며 다양한 데이터를 처리하게 됩니다. 이러한 데이터를 어떻게 관리하고, 어떻게 시각화할지는 매우 중요한 과정입니다. 데이터 시각화 도구를 활용하면 프로젝의 결과를 한눈에 볼 수 있도록 도와줍니다. 예를 들어, Matplotlib이나 Seaborn과 같은 라이브러리를 사용하여 시각적인 차트와 그래프를 만드는 것도 좋은 방법이에요. 데이터의 흐름을 시각적으로 표현한다면 그동안의 노력의 결과를 더 확실하게 볼 수 있죠!
위에서 다룬 다양한 미니 프로젝트에서 수집된 데이터를 표로 정리하는 것도 좋은 방법입니다. 아래의 표는 예를 들어, 특정 프로젝트에서 사용했던 주요 라이브러리와 그에 따른 특징을 정리한 것이다. 이 표를 통해 실제 프로젝트에서 활용할 라이브러리의 선택을 좀 더 신중하게 할 수 있게 됩니다.
라이브러리 | 용도 | 특징 |
---|---|---|
Pandas | 데이터 분석 | 데이터 처리와 분석을 쉽게 할 수 있음 |
Matplotlib | 데이터 시각화 | 여러 종류의 그래프와 차트를 그릴 수 있음 |
Flask | 웹 애플리케이션 | 빠르게 웹 서버를 구축할 수 있게 도와줌 |
Tkinter | GUI 개발 | 간단하게 데스크탑 애플리케이션 만들기 가능 |
이처럼 직접 프로젝트를 수행하며 수집한 데이터와 경험들을 종합하여 정리하는 것은 스스로의 성장을 다시 한번 돌아보게 만드는 기회를 제공합니다. 다시 한 번 스스로가 얼마나 많은 것을 배우고 있는지를 인식하면서, 다음 프로젝트에 대한 계획을 세우는 건 어떨까요? 끊임없는 학습과 성취는 여러분을 더욱 강하게 만들어줄 것입니다!
결국 파이썬에서 미니 프로젝트로 실력 키우기란 끊임없는 도전이고, 그 도전 속에서 여러분은 훌륭한 개발자로 나아가는 길을 걷게 되실 것입니다. 이 글을 통해 여러분이 차근차근 자신의 목표를 이뤄가기를 바랍니다. 자, 이제 여러분의 첫 번째 미니 프로젝트를 실천에 옮겨볼 시간입니다!
이런 글도 읽어보세요
파이썬과 SQL 연동하기: 데이터 분석의 새로운 길!
1. 파이썬과 SQL 연동하기의 중요성데이터 분석의 세계에서 파이썬과 SQL의 결합은 마치 두 개의 우주가 만나는 것과 같습니다. 파이썬은 유연하고 강력한 프로그래밍 언어로, 대량의 데이터를 다
hgpaazx.tistory.com
파이썬으로 데이터 시각화 도구 비교, 최적 선택은?
추천 글 파이썬에서 제너레이터와 이터레이터 이해하기: 프로그래밍의 새로운 지평 1. 파이썬에서 제너레이터와 이터레이터 이해하기의 등장파이썬에서는 프로그래밍의 세계가 한층 넓어지
hgpaazx.tistory.com
파이썬에서 Git과 협업하기, 효율적인 코드 관리 비법
추천 글 파이썬에서 예외 처리 기본 배우기: 초보자를 위한 가이드 예외 처리의 중요성 이해하기파이썬에서 예외 처리 기본 배우기는 프로그래밍에서 중요한 개념입니다. 많은 초보자들이 단
hgpaazx.tistory.com
FAQ
1. 파이썬에서 미니 프로젝트는 왜 중요한가요?
파이썬에서 미니 프로젝트를 통해 실력을 키우는 것은 실제 코딩 경험이 쌓일 수 있는 기회를 제공합니다. 이 과정에서 배우는 문제 해결 능력과 창의력은 개발자가 되기 위한 필수 요소입니다.
2. 어떤 미니 프로젝트를 시작해야 할까요?
처음에는 간단한 To-Do 리스트 앱이나 날씨를 조회하는 프로그램 같은 주제로 시작해보세요. 그 후 점차 난이도를 높여 가며 다양한 프로젝트에 도전하는 것이 좋습니다.
3. 미니 프로젝트의 결과물을 어떻게 공유하나요?
GitHub에 올리거나 블로그에 기록해 보세요. 또한, 관련 커뮤니티에 게시하여 피드백을 받아보는 것도 좋은 방법입니다. 여러분의 경험과 지식을 나누면 더 크게 성장할 수 있을 것입니다!
'일상추천' 카테고리의 다른 글
파이썬으로 머신러닝 데이터 전처리하기, 효과적인 팁 공개 (0) | 2024.12.23 |
---|---|
파이썬으로 웹 애플리케이션 배포하기, 2023년 최신 팁 (0) | 2024.12.23 |
파이썬으로 영상 처리 기초 배우기, 시작해볼까요? (2) | 2024.12.22 |
파이썬으로 텍스트 마이닝 기법 배우기, 데이터의 새로운 세계 (3) | 2024.12.22 |
파이썬에서 문자열 처리 함수 모음, 효과적인 활용법 정리 (0) | 2024.12.22 |